The Evolution of Car Keys
1. Conventional Keys:
In the early days of automotive history, car keys were simple metal cut keys, utilized solely to mechanically unlock doors and start the vehicle. These conventional keys were easy to duplicate but didn’t use much in terms of security.
2. Transponder Keys:
Introduced in the mid-1990s, transponder keys transformed automotive security. Embedded with a microchip, these keys send out an unique signal to the car’s ignition system. Cars will just begin if they recognize the appropriate signal, including a layer of security versus theft.
3. Remote Key Fobs:
Remote key fobs enable keyless entry, making it convenient for users to access their lorries with the touch of a button. These fobs usually likewise control car alarms, providing extra security features.
4. Smart Keys and Keyless Ignition:
The most current in automotive key technology, smart keys or proximity keys enable users to start and stop the vehicle with a push-button ignition system. They enable the vehicle to recognize when the key neighbors, offering unequaled benefit and security.
The Role of a Car Locksmith
Car locksmiths are highly skilled experts who focus on a variety of services. Here are some of their primary responsibilities:
Key Replacement and Duplication:
Whether due to loss, theft, or damage, replacing car keys is among the most typical tasks carried out by locksmith professionals. With their competence, they can duplicate and replace traditional, transponder, and even some wise keys.
Lockout Services:
Being locked out of a vehicle is a common problem faced by lots of motorists. Locksmiths take advantage of specialized tools and techniques to safely unlock car doors without triggering any damage.
Ignition Repair and Replacement:
Issues with a car’s ignition system can avoid a vehicle from beginning. Locksmiths assess these problems and can repair or replace ignitions as essential.
Programming Transponder Keys:
Given the intricacy related to transponder keys, locksmiths typically help with programming them to interact with a vehicle’s ignition system.
Advanced Security System Installation:
Modern vehicles typically come equipped with advanced security systems. Car locksmiths offer setup and maintenance services for these sophisticated systems to guarantee they operate properly.
The Technology Behind Lock and Key Security
Improvements in technology have changed how locksmith professionals work. Here’s a glance into some of the key technologies used today:
-
Laser Key Cutting: Laser cutting machines are used for high precision, guaranteeing keys fit completely into their particular locks.
-
OBD-II Programming Tools: On-Board Diagnostics (OBD) tools help locksmiths in accessing a car’s computer system to program keys, particularly for more recent models.
-
Key Code Retrieval: Modern locksmiths can obtain distinct Car key and Locksmith key codes from manufacturers, making it possible for precise duplication and programming.
FAQs About Car Key and Locksmith Services
-
What should I do if I lose my car keys?
- Contact an expert locksmith who can replace your keys. Ensure to offer evidence of ownership for the vehicle.
-
Can a locksmith make a key for a car without the original?
- Yes, many locksmiths can produce a key utilizing the vehicle’s ignition lock or by recovering the key code.
-
How long does it take to replace a car key?
- The time can differ depending upon the key type and the locksmith’s availability, with traditional keys taking less time compared to transponder and clever keys.
-
Is it more affordable to go to a locksmith or a dealership for key replacement?
- Generally, locksmiths offer more cost-efficient options compared to dealerships for key replacement services.
-
Can locksmith professionals program all types of car keys?
- While many locksmiths can deal with a wide variety of keys, some state-of-the-art designs may require specific services available only through the dealer.
